Output 43dc953d401d3274b41703ab5f8bac99994f5f073ceac700caab844b24aa62ec:0

value
8142
script pubkey
OP_0 OP_PUSHBYTES_20 5156bf9ae6f2c6e42eba3a9f84c3b92bcbc89a67
address
bc1q29ttlxhx7trwgt46820cfsae909u3xn8fffy7u
transaction
43dc953d401d3274b41703ab5f8bac99994f5f073ceac700caab844b24aa62ec
confirmations
333434
spent
true